Nitric Acid Oxidation of Silver
3Ag + 4HNO3(dilute) → 3AgNO3 + NO + 2H2O
概述
Dilute nitric acid dissolves silver metal, oxidizing it to Ag⁺ while the nitrate is reduced to NO gas. Silver does not dissolve in HCl or H₂SO₄(dilute) because the H⁺ ion cannot oxidize silver, but nitric acid's nitrate ion provides sufficient oxidizing power. This is part of the aqua regia chemistry for noble metals.

日常示例
Jewelers use nitric acid to test whether a piece is real silver, as silver dissolves producing a green solution.
工业重要性
硝酸银广泛用于摄影、电镀和医疗器械涂层。硝酸溶银是银精炼与回收的基础工艺。
